    Keith Tuffley

    Global Co-Head, Sustainability & Corporate Transitions group, Citi

    Professional Background

    Keith Tuffley is a distinguished leader in the field of sustainability and corporate transitions, currently serving as the Global Co-Head of Citi's Sustainability & Corporate Transitions group within the Banking, Capital Markets & Advisory division. In this vital role, he provides strategic advice to CEOs, CFOs, and Boards on critical aspects related to moving their organizations towards a net-zero emissions future and achieving a 100% sustainable operation. He specializes in corporate strategy, innovation, mergers and acquisitions (M&A), and sustainable finance solutions, equipping businesses to seize opportunities arising from the ongoing Sustainability Revolution.

    As a forward-thinking entrepreneur, Keith has also established NEUW Ventures SA in 2012, an impact investment company based in Switzerland dedicated to financing and creating innovative businesses aimed at reducing the human ecological footprint. Notable initiatives from NEUW Ventures include the Grand Tours Project, which offers extraordinary cycling tours, and the Abel Tasman Yacht Adventures—specializing in Arctic sailing cruises.

    Before his tenure at NEUW Ventures, Keith served as the CEO of The B Team, an influential NGO founded by prominent figures like Sir Richard Branson of Virgin and Jochen Zeitz, the former CEO of Puma. Under his leadership from 2014 to 2017, The B Team played a crucial role in advocating for sustainable business practices while working towards significant global goals, including the Paris Agreement and the Sustainable Development Goals. Their advocacy emphasized achieving "Net-Zero by 2050," highlighting the positive role businesses can assume in addressing pressing global challenges.

    Prior to his roles in sustainability, Keith built a formidable career in investment banking, notably at Goldman Sachs from 2002 to 2007, where he held positions as a Partner, Managing Director, and Head of Investment Banking for Australia and New Zealand. Under his stewardship, the division ascended to a top-three market position, thanks in part to the merger with JBWere. Later, as Head of Industrials for Europe, the Middle East, and Africa (EMEA), Keith further cemented his reputation for excellence in the capital markets.

    Throughout his career, Keith has also made substantial contributions as a board member and advisor to various ecological and sustainability-focused organizations, including serving as Chairman of the Global Footprint Network, Governor at WWF-Australia, and a Global Ambassador to the Wilderness Foundation. He has been deeply engaged with various initiatives aimed at promoting environmental sustainability and advocating for natural conservation.

    Education and Achievements

    Keith Tuffley boasts an impressive academic background, with degrees from renowned institutions that underscore his commitment to sustainability and leadership. He holds a Masters of Sustainability Leadership (MSt.) from the University of Cambridge, emphasizing his advanced understanding in sustainability studies. Further, he has completed the Non-Profit Leadership Programme at Harvard University and the Advanced Management Program at INSEAD, which have enriched his leadership capabilities in diverse contexts.

    In addition to his sustainability credentials, Keith completed both a Masters of Laws (LLM) and a Bachelor of Laws (LLB) at the prestigious University of Sydney, coupled with a Bachelor of Economics (BEc).     Adventure and Personal Pursuits

    Beyond his professional accomplishments, Keith is a passionate adventurer, engaging in strenuous and thrilling activities that not only challenge him physically but also raise awareness about sustainability. His exploits include skiing to the last 1.5 degrees to the North Pole and cycling and skiing a groundbreaking route to the South Pole, traversing 620 kilometers over 35 days through rugged terrain. Keith's ambition led him to conquer most of the 4,000-meter peaks in the Alps and embark on sailing expeditions to Antarctica.

    Remarkably, he was the first amateur cyclist to complete all three Grand Tours—Tour de France, Giro d'Italia, and La Vuelta a España—over a single season, covering an astounding 10,500 kilometers and climbing an elevation of 150,000 meters.
